💻Oracle中的`TO_DATE()`:揭秘24小时制的奥秘⏰

导读 在使用Oracle数据库时,`TO_DATE()`函数是一个非常实用的工具,用于将字符串转换为日期类型。然而,当你处理时间格式时,可能会遇到一个有...

在使用Oracle数据库时,`TO_DATE()`函数是一个非常实用的工具,用于将字符串转换为日期类型。然而,当你处理时间格式时,可能会遇到一个有趣的问题——24小时制的设定。🤔

想象一下,你输入的时间是`"13:00"`,但输出却变成了`"01:00 PM"`,这可能是因为你的系统默认使用的是12小时制。如果需要严格以24小时制显示,就需要特别注意格式化参数的设置。💡

正确的写法应该是在`TO_DATE()`中加入明确的格式掩码,比如`"HH24"`来确保时间始终以24小时制显示。例如:

```sql

SELECT TO_DATE('13:00', 'HH24:MI') FROM dual;

```

这样就能避免混淆,让时间显示更加直观和精确!🌟

无论是开发还是数据分析,掌握这一技巧都能帮助你更高效地处理时间数据,避免不必要的错误哦!💪

Oracle TO_DATE 24小时制

免责声明:本文由用户上传,如有侵权请联系删除!

猜你喜欢

最新文章